      Its hard for me to have LDs, and when I do, they're quick and over with in seconds.

      I think I know why -
      It's a weird problem I've had since I was a little kid:
      When I was around 5 I dreamt that a person was walking down the street.
      Suddenly a big black hole ends up on the ground in the guy falls into the hole. He returns back to where he was, falls into the hole again, and repeats the process. Soon I give up on trying to think about this and the guy falls and keeps falling and falling...

      Recently, I was day-dreaming about being an actor, the camera went to me and I began to act. Suddenly the camera went on some kind of railroad track and circles me. "Ok, that's stupid" I think, and bring it back.
      As soon as I place the camera back it begins to go in circles again, over and over!! I wanted to continued the "scene", so I sort of carried out 2 thoughts. One of the circling camera and another of the scene. It was really hard to stop my mind from fixating on that goddamn camera!

      It PISSES ME OFF! It's like there's a part of my mind that really wants me to be angry and annoyed, so it screws up a daydream and the repeats that motion over and over and over.

      I'm sure you'll say "Ah just ignore it and it'll go away" but it doesn't! If I ignore it it will just keep going, like a scratched disc or something.

      Anyway, this affects my LDs - without control over my mind it jumps to some random thought and I lose control and instantly wake up.

      What do you guys think this is? Know any ways to solving it?
